Thanks!
Bliz-
Just a quick line to let you know how much we
are
enjoying the lures. We originally got them to try on
the wirelines for Wahoo and they work GREAT! Since
I've had a little time to play with them I've also
had
great results pulling them on the flat lines and even
tweaked them a little by taking the hook off the back
plug to use as Billfish teasers and the Sailfish love
them.
To date we have caught Wahoo, Tuna, Dolphin, and
Kingfish on the lure as you ship them and have bait
and switched a pile of Sailfish on them as teasers
as
well. The only negative I can comment on is the fact
that they give me a HEART ATTACK every time I turn
around and see them swimming in the water since they
look so real. I'll forward my next order along soon.
Thanks getting them out so quick-
—Captain
George LaBonte

Charter
captains are probably some of the world’s most
cynical individuals when it comes to employing new tactics
or tackle, be in upon the inshore or offshore arenas.
You can definitely put my name in the category of those
who are generally unimpressed by the claims that are
typically attached to new fishing lures. However, every
now and then someone really does conceive ‘A better
mousetrap.’
The former conviction was my first
impression when I employed the prototype of the Bliz
Lures Bait Simulator,
but the latter conviction soon won out once the various
species of tuna and other game fish started nibbling
on it with great regularity.
There are several reasons
why anglers would want to use the Bliz Live Bait
Simulator. This lure is easily
stored, effortlessly employed, and is highly effective
when used either as a trolling lure or as a teaser.
While highly successful as a lure, when used as a teaser,
the enticing swimming action attracts fish from the
depths to investigate both its visual and hydro-sonic
characteristics. When you see the hookless teasers
and dropped back hook-bait ‘working’ behind
the boat, you’ll instantly understand why this
lure can be said to be ‘better than bait’ as
it truly does look like a school of baitfish swimming
through the upper water column just below the barrier
that the surface provides.
Whether used in pursuit of
piscatorial quarry in the near coastal waters, in
the Northeast canyons, or in
azure blue waters of the tropics, the Bliz Lure Bait
Simulator is an innovation that really works when it
comes to attracting and catching big fish because of
its versatility and catch-ability. When you watch the
video you’ll instantly become a believer in regards
to how the realistic swimming action will help you
put some big fish on the deck
—Captain
Bill Brown of Billfisher Charter |
